The Be Podcast Network has partnered with Belouga and the #SameHere Global Mental Health Movement for the fourth annual #SameHere Schools Month in May 2023. Here’s what you can expect this month: 12+ episodes featuring educators, authors, mental health professionals, and other leading experts and influencers. Content focused on the mission to highlight quality mental health resources, engage in conversations that help us create mutual understanding, and connect across the planet. Best practices for mental health, overall wellness, and positive culture change in school communities. Why Community is the Foundation of Learning with Ross Romano, Rola Tibshirani, Marisa Jackson, Tracy Mergler, and Elizabeth McDonald

This session looks at the multiple definitions of community and its importance in establishing the right conditions for learning. The discussion includes:

  • The elements of a supportive community
  • The upside of accountability
  • Building a professional network that supports wellness and growth
  • What it means to receive permission to teach
  • The relationship between community in professional learning and classroom learning
  • How engagement with diverse perspectives and experiences supports learning and mental wellness


Speakers:


Ross Romano (@RossBRomano)

Ross Romano is a co-founder of the Be Podcast Network and CEO of September Strategies, a coaching and consulting firm that helps organizations and high-performing leaders in the K-12 education industry and beyond clarify their vision and make strategic decisions that lead to long-term success. Connect on LinkedIn. 


Rola Tibshirani (@rolat)

Rola is Vice Principal of St. Benedict School in Ottawa, Ontario, Canada. Read her blog at https://learningprogression.blogspot.com/ 


Tracy Mergler (@TracyMergler)

Tracy is a special education teacher and founder of Safe Space Organization, a non-clinical, community safe space that strives to change the conversation around mental health by educating, connecting and supporting others through a peer-to-peer network. Learn more: https://www.safespacecny.com/ 


Marisa Jackson (@MarisaLVJackson)

Marisa is Principal of Woodbridge Elementary School in Rhode Island. She is passionate about all things SEL. 


Elizabeth McDonald (@MrsEM_McDonald)

Elizabeth is a middle school principal who will soon transition to the role of Assistant Superintendent for Instruction.
